Overview

MP High Court Assistant Grade-3 Recruitment 2026 is officially out — the High Court of Madhya Pradesh, Jabalpur, has announced a massive 1,174 vacancies for Assistant Grade-3 posts to be filled through direct recruitment across District and Sessions Courts throughout Madhya Pradesh. This is being described as the largest single intake of Assistant Grade-3 posts in the MP judiciary's recent recruitment history, and it marks a major opportunity for graduates statewide seeking a stable government job in the state judicial administration. Of the total 1,174 posts, 1,021 are confirmed main vacancies and 153 are provisional, with reservation norms including 35% horizontal reservation for women, 10% for Ex-Servicemen, and 6% for Persons with Disabilities applying across the drive. Selected Assistant Grade-3 candidates will be posted to District and Sessions Courts across Madhya Pradesh, handling core administrative, clerical, and case-management support functions within the state judiciary. The selection process for MP High Court Assistant Grade-3 2026 consists of an Online Preliminary Examination, followed by a Hindi Typing Skill Test for shortlisted candidates, and further document verification and selection formalities. The salary for MP High Court Assistant Grade-3 2026 is set at Pay Level 4 under the 7th Pay Commission Pay Matrix, with a basic pay range of ₹19,500 to ₹62,000 per month, plus DA, HRA, and Transport Allowance as applicable to Madhya Pradesh state government employees. The MP High Court Assistant Grade-3 2026 online application is available at mphc.gov.in/recruitment, opening 17 August 2026 at 12:00 PM. The last date to apply for MP High Court Assistant Grade-3 Recruitment 2026 is 15 September 2026 up to 5:00 PM, with a correction window open from 19 to 21 September 2026 for candidates to fix errors in their submitted forms. Candidates must possess a Graduation degree, a valid CPCT scorecard, and a recognised computer qualification to be eligible, and should read the complete official MP High Court Assistant Grade-3 2026 notification PDF at mphc.gov.in before applying, given the scale and competitiveness of this drive.

Qualification

Graduation degree in any discipline from a recognised university, along with a valid CPCT (Computer Proficiency Certification Test) scorecard issued by MP Agency for Promotion of Information Technology (MAP-IT) or a recognised equivalent agency. Candidates must also hold a 1-year Computer Application diploma, or a recognised alternative such as O-Level from DOEACC/NIELIT, a COPA Certificate from a Government ITI, Modern Office Management certification, or a higher computer qualification, as detailed in the official notification.

Age Limit

  • Minimum age: 18 years
  • Maximum age: 40 years
  • Age relaxation applicable for SC/ST/OBC/PwBD and other reserved categories as per Madhya Pradesh Government norms — refer to the official notification for exact category-wise relaxation

Eligibility

  • Graduation degree in any discipline from a recognised university
  • Valid CPCT (Computer Proficiency Certification Test) scorecard from MAP-IT or a recognised equivalent agency
  • 1-year Computer Application diploma, or an accepted equivalent such as O-Level (DOEACC/NIELIT), COPA Certificate (Government ITI), or Modern Office Management qualification
  • Age: 18 to 40 years, with standard MP Government relaxation for SC/ST/OBC/PwBD/Ex-Servicemen categories
  • Candidates applying from outside Madhya Pradesh will be considered strictly under the General category
  • 35% horizontal reservation for women, 10% for Ex-Servicemen, and 6% for Persons with Disabilities applies across all category vacancies
  • Candidates must clear each stage of selection — Preliminary Examination, Hindi Typing Test, and Document Verification — in sequence to be considered for final selection
